Understanding Magnetic Resonance Imaging (MRI)
MRI uses a strong magnetic field and radio waves to produce detailed images of organs, tissues, and bones. Unlike X-rays, which only show the structure of bones, MRI provides a more comprehensive view of the body's internal structures, including muscles, tendons, ligaments, and nerves.

How to Prepare for Your MRI-MV Scan:
Pre-Scan Instructions:
Your doctor will provide you with specific instructions on how to prepare for your MRI-MV scan. These instructions may include:
- Fasting: Depending on the area being scanned, you may need to fast for a certain period before the scan.
- Medication: You may be asked to stop taking certain medications before the scan.
- Metal objects: You will need to remove all metal objects, including jewelry, watches, and piercings, before the scan.
- Clothing: You will be asked to change into a gown for the scan.
What to Bring to Your Appointment:
Bring the following items to your MRI-MV appointment:
- Insurance card: To ensure proper billing for your scan.
- Photo ID: For verification purposes.
- List of medications: Including dosages and times taken.
- Medical history: Including any relevant medical conditions or allergies.
- Pre-scan instructions: Be sure to review the instructions provided by your doctor.
What to Expect During the Scan:
- The scan will take place in a large, cylindrical machine called an MRI scanner.
- You will lie on a table that slides into the scanner.
- The scanner will make loud noises during the scan, so earplugs or headphones may be provided.
- You will need to lie still during the scan, as any movement can affect the quality of the images.
- The scan typically takes 30-60 minutes, depending on the area being scanned.
- The MRI technician will be in another room and will be able to monitor you during the scan.

Is the MRI-MV Scan Painful?
The MRI-MV scan is a non-invasive procedure, and there is no pain associated with the scan itself. However, you may experience some discomfort from lying still for an extended period.
How Long Does the Scan Take?
The scan typically takes 30-60 minutes, depending on the area being scanned.
What are the Potential Risks of an MRI-MV?
MRI-MV scans are generally considered safe. However, as with any medical procedure, there are some potential risks, such as:
- Allergic reactions: To contrast dye, if used.
- Claustrophobia: Due to the enclosed nature of the MRI scanner.
- Metal objects: You must remove all metal objects before the scan, as they can interfere with the MRI machine.
